Woking, Surrey – 21st May 2015 – “An acceptance that security will be breached in most organisations will mean some change of focus at this year’s Infosecurity Europe exhibition,” said Ian Kilpatrick, chairman of Wick Hill Group, security specialist and long time exhibitor at the show.

“It’s no longer a question of if, but when, your defences are breached,” said Kilpatrick, “and the show will therefore be covering the protection of key data, as well as the identification and management of breaches, alongside endpoint and perimeter defence solutions.

“Companies will be looking at how to manage this change in security within their budgets. Solutions that provide more management information around security and security breaches, as well as those that promote more security awareness amongst staff, will also get a lot of attention.”
